For me, "quiet and less raspy" are (usually) a function of calls made of thinner material (.003, proph) with the reeds stretched very slightly. You can get really good-sounding soft clucks, yelps, tree calls, purrs, and kee-kees with two-reed and even single reed calls.
If you order calls and don't get the sounds you are looking for, you can often achieve those sounds with very slight modifications to the reeds (cuts, stretching, partial reed removal). Almost any call will get you where you want to be by doing those modifications a little at a time.
